These pictures are from our 2009 trip to California. We spent an entire day at Universal Studios.. much to my dismay, my kids are huge Simpsons fans... so I played along when they tried on the "Marge" wigs.. my hubby however chickened out!



My "textures" are I stamped the title with Versamark and then heat embossed with blue embossing powder. I also used Sook Wang, or Score Tape on some cardstock and then punched the stars, with my new favourite Jolee's punch. I then peeled the backing and rubbed Ultra Fine 'Cool' glitter on them. They don't photograph well, but let me tell you.. they sparkle!!
